Key Market Indicators
Swedish beer sales are projected to reach €846 million by 2028, up from €833 million in 2023. This marks a modest annual growth rate of 0.3%. Over the past decade, however, the market has declined by an average of 1.2% per year. In the 2023 global ranking, Sweden stood at number 13, with Portugal slightly ahead at €833 million. The United Kingdom, Spain, and Belgium occupied the second, third, and fourth positions, respectively. Meanwhile, Swedish beer production is expected to hit 517,000 metric tons by 2028, rising from 501,000 metric tons in 2023. This indicates an average annual growth rate of 0.6%. Since 1966, Swedish beer supply has grown by an average of 0.8% per year. In 2023, Sweden ranked 49th in global beer production, with Tanzania just ahead at 501,000 metric tons. The United States, Brazil, and Mexico secured the second, third, and fourth spots in this category.
